Russia and Vietnam Advocate for the Establishment of an Independent Palestine

20 June

Moscow and Hanoi are convinced that the Middle East crisis should be resolved through the establishment of an independent Palestinian state. This was stated in a joint declaration by Russia and Vietnam on further deepening their comprehensive strategic partnership.

 

"The parties are united in their desire to strengthen peace and stability in the Middle East, oppose interference in the internal affairs of countries in the region, and express their commitment to a comprehensive, just, and long-term resolution of the Palestinian issue based on well-known international legal principles. The key element of this is the two-state solution, which envisions the creation of an independent Palestinian state within the 1967 borders, with East Jerusalem as its capital, coexisting in peace and security with Israel," the document states.
